EEPROM

EEPROM is an IC (Integrated Circuit) that stores information or data. It is a non-volatile memory and keeps its stored data even when the power is turned off. It is the latest version of EPROM which was invented in 1978. It utilizes electricity instead of UV radiation to erase its contents. It can be reprogrammed indefinitely. It can serve as a chip to store configurations, parameters, or calibration coefficients.

Subaru-logo.pngModern car keys differ from traditional keys because they contain a transponder in them. The chip triggers the immobilizer on the inside of the vehicle. This is the reason why the car key has to be programmed to match the immobilizer code of the vehicle to enable it to function. Onboard

It is crucial to program your car keys correctly, or else you may cause serious damage. You should only hire an expert locksmith who has the proper equipment to perform the job. If you're considering this route, make sure they're insured to cover any injuries or damages that happen during the process.

To start, modern cars require a special microchip. If this chip isn't programmed correctly the car will not turn on. The majority of people call locksmiths to program a car key. This process is often much more simple than it appears. You can find the steps in your car's owner's manual, or search on the internet for "onboard programing steps for X vehicle."

Onboard key programming is a simple procedure that does not require a car key programmers. It involves a few easy steps that put the car in "learn-mode," which allows you program additional FOBs, or a spare. This method may not be supported by all vehicles and the computer of your car might limit its coverage. It's also not as quick as EEPROM or OBD2 programs.

Modern cars typically require a transponder chip programmed to the particular car. The key can't start the car without this program. This can be done at a locksmith shop or using the device specifically designed for programming car keys. The device must be plugged into the car's OBD2 connector, which will send the code to the chip. The code will be altered to match the car's system.

Some older vehicles may not have this system and may require a traditional blade style key that is put into the ignition cylinder. Many auto shops can program these, even although they are more difficult to program. They usually charge more but they are more likely to have the correct equipment.

Another kind of advanced car key programming is the EEPROM method. This method is utilized on modern vehicles such as BMWs and Mercedes. This is a complex procedure that requires soldering, circuit boards and programming skills. It is crucial to hire an expert for this, because the wrong procedure could damage the information on the module. This could cause the vehicle to not start or create other problems.
